Handover: report exports in Larkspin. All timestamps now stored UTC; conversion happens at render using the org's tz setting, not the requester's. Removed the double-offset bug in the CSV path. Watch the DST boundary tests — they're load-bearing. Migration backfill is done. Review focus: exporter.py diff only. To re-run the signed backfill job, enter the recovery passphrase below.

recovery phrase for fahif-hadup: sorix-holael

### Audit Item 14 — Laundry-Locker Access Flow

Verify that the WashPoint locker access flow enforces single-use unlock codes and expires them within ten minutes of issue. Confirm audit logs capture every unlock attempt, including failures, and that logs retain entries for ninety days. Check that maintenance override codes rotate monthly and are never reused across the Ferncliff sites. Record any deviation as a finding with severity. If enforcement gaps are found, report them immediately to the accountable engineer named below.

named custodian: Oliath Ralax

**Q: How do I run LiftSim locally for review?**

LiftSim replays recorded dispatch traces against the candidate scheduler and diffs wait-time percentiles. Use the bundled `traces/midrise` set; the tower set needs the encrypted fixtures bundle. To decrypt the fixtures on a fresh checkout, enter the recovery passphrase shown directly beneath this entry.

strongbox words: zorwyn-sorael-belion-ulaius-silmir-ulays-briax-rusdor-gorix